ART – Day by Day

by Rosemary Schram

Here is my Index Card Challenge for the month of June.

Use index cards to create small art pieces daily. This

allows you to quickly connect to your creative self each

day which then empowers you to create even larger

connections in life.

Try creating a stained glass window

effect using colored markers.

Vary the position of the Index Card to

create a different effect. This was done

mostly with highlighters and line

markers.

Add writing to your art to give it a

personal touch. This was made with

acrylic paints and a black marker.

Experiment with images that can

be flipped in different directions.

Made with acrylic paints.

Allow your writing to come

from your art. Made using

markers and highlighters.

Inspired writing from art made using

kids colored tempera paint sticks.

Collage made using shiny paper cut

into a spiral shape holding a 3D

butterfly sticker.

Stamping art made with acrylic

paint, sponges and circle patterns.

Caterpillar created with circles

cut from shiny paper on a

background of glitter glue.

Use your favorite character trait and

ignite it with color and texture.

Collage made with yarn, ribbon,

washi tape and tissue paper.

Use only colorful glitter glue

and see what you can create.

Spring or summer flowers

made using chalk pastels.

Combine geometric shapes and

a background of colored sand

to produce textural art.

Splatter painting on a coffee filter.

Add some lines with a metallic marker.

Geometric shapes using colored

pencils with a feather added for fun.

Consider adding lots of dots to

your next abstract art picture.

Outlining shapes can put a

unique emphasis on them.

Abstract art may actually have images

hidden in it. Be sure to turn your

picture in all directions to see them.

Play with ways to put words

and movement in your art.

Layer geometric shapes and then

turn some in other directions.

Stamping is fun when you add

metallic paint or metallic markers.

Paint a picture and add stickers or

page markers for a 3D look.

Mix and match foam stickers added

to a picture made with markers.

Create Zentangle type shapes on Rainbow

Scratch Off paper. Then cut them out and add

additional colors with markers for a new look.

Take a clue from a

sticker and expand it.

Even varying the sizes of just one

shape can make an interesting drawing.

Look through magazines and find an

interesting image. Then add words

or colors to make it your own.

Try reusing old cards. Cut out images

from them. Then add words and

stickers to bring them back to life.

Layer small textured material

samples, stickers and words for

a special one of a kind message.
